New Holland 2053: 5 Volt Reference Voltage Too High

Issue description

The system has detected that the 5 Volt Reference Voltage is higher than the expected range. This may affect the proper operation of sensors or electronic components that rely on this reference voltage.

Check the cause

  1. Power supply circuit

  2. Voltage regulation circuit

  3. Sensor connections

Repair steps

  1. Inspect

    Inspect the power supply circuit for any signs of damage or malfunction.

  2. Test

    Test the voltage regulation circuit to ensure it is maintaining the correct 5 Volt Reference Voltage.

  3. Check

    Check all sensor connections for loose, damaged, or corroded wiring.
